Css object typescript

WebHow TypeScript describes the shapes of JavaScript objects. In an object destructuring pattern, shape: Shape means “grab the property shape and redefine it locally as a … WebMay 25, 2024 · It works like this: you import the CSS as a JavaScript module , which have been mapped from your CSS class names and assign those as className properties in …

Typescript How to convert/parse String text to JSON Object Cloudhad…

WebThe css template function takes CSS and returns an object you can pass to your components. The properties are compatible with CSS.Properties from csstype. In fact, it uses csstype under the ... To make things work with … WebSep 17, 2024 · Add the following code to App.css for the opacity hover effect. 1 .click:hover { 2 opacity: 0.3; 3 } CSS. You can see the above code in action by hovering on the button. Color Change. As discussed in the above example, you can change the button's color using a hover selector like this. the range clothing brand https://mugeguren.com

Using styled-components in TypeScript: A tutorial with …

WebA class with only a single instance is typically just represented as a normal object in JavaScript/TypeScript. For example, we don’t need a “static class” syntax in TypeScript because a regular object (or even top-level function) will do the job just as well: class MyStaticClass {. static doSomething () {} WebThese css objects are then passed into your chosen css-in-js library without the need for an extra client-side bundle: ```js import tw from 'twin.macro' tw`text-sm md:text-lg` // ↓ ↓ ↓ ↓ ↓ ↓ { fontSize: '0.875rem', '@media (min-width: 768px)': { fontSize: '1.125rem', }, } ``` ## Features ** 👌 Simple imports** - Twin collapses ... WebMar 26, 2024 · The new CSS Typed Object Model (Typed OM), part of the Houdini effort, expands this worldview by adding types, methods, and a proper object model to CSS values. Instead of strings, values are exposed as JavaScript objects to facilitate performant (and sensible) manipulation of CSS. the range contact email address

CSSStyleDeclaration Object - W3School

Category:How to use CSS Modules with TypeScript and webpack

Tags:Css object typescript

Css object typescript

CSS in TypeScript with vanilla-extract CSS-Tricks

WebNov 7, 2024 · A CSSStyleDeclaration is the same sort of situation, except with lots more properties. Partial is the right way to go, but unfortunately, since … WebMar 2, 2024 · Expanding interfaces in TypeScript. Option 1: Declaration merging. Declaration merging to wrangle disparate user preferences. Option 2: Extending interfaces in TypeScript. Extending multiple interfaces in TypeScript. Extending interfaces to form a type-safe global state store. Extending types. Use cases for interfaces in TypeScript.

Css object typescript

Did you know?

WebBinding to multiple CSS classes link. To bind to multiple classes, type the following: [class]="classExpression". The expression can be one of: A space-delimited string of class names. An object with class names as the keys and truthy or falsy expressions as the values. An array of class names. With the object format, Angular adds a class only ... WebMay 11, 2024 · Now you need Button.css.d.ts like this: export const foo: string; export const barBaz: string; typings-for-css-modules-loader is a drop-in replacement for css-loader …

WebApr 12, 2024 · The main reason for defining a particular structure for an object is to enable static type checking, which ensures that the variable holding your data and the data you expect to be stored in it match, especially in the case of complex data. Let’s explore two approaches for defining an TypeScript object structure. WebTo compile your TypeScript code, you can open the Integrated Terminal ( Ctrl+`) and type tsc helloworld.ts. This will compile and create a new helloworld.js JavaScript file. If you have Node.js installed, you can run node helloworld.js. If you open helloworld.js, you'll see that it doesn't look very different from helloworld.ts.

WebDec 22, 2024 · Rosebox is a CSS-in-Typescript library that provides features like strong types(e.g., Angle), typed functions (e.g., linearGradient), additional shorthand … WebCSSStyleDeclaration Object Properties. Property. Description. cssText. Sets or returns the textual representation of a CSS declaration block. length. Returns the number of style declarations in a CSS declaration block. parentRule. …

WebDec 10, 2024 · The CSS Object Model is a set of APIs allowing the manipulation of CSS from JavaScript. It is much like the DOM, but for the CSS rather than the HTML. It allows users to read and modify CSS style …

WebJan 27, 2024 · We can do this by using mini-css-extract-plugin instead of style-loader. Let’s start by installing mini-css-extract-plugin with its TypeScript types: npm install --save … the range cork floor tilesWebMay 25, 2024 · It works like this: you import the CSS as a JavaScript module , which have been mapped from your CSS class names and assign those as className properties in the JSX. I used the npm package … the range coolock websiteWebJan 27, 2011 · Current: Director of Engineering at Yuga Labs. As Dev Manager at Wenew, I worked on building out a high caliber … therange co uk rp facet dog ke micto beadsWebThe level is determined by a majority opinion of students who have reviewed this class. The teacher's recommendation is shown until at least 5 student responses are collected. ... the range cork online shoppingWebAbout. "I can be better than my yesterday's self." - Altemush Bhatti. Software Engineer with a Bachelor’s Degree in Computer Engineering … signs of a broken toe knuckleWebMay 11, 2024 · Now you need Button.css.d.ts like this: export const foo: string; export const barBaz: string; typings-for-css-modules-loader is a drop-in replacement for css-loader … therange.co.uk sourcingWebTypeScript provides a convenient way to define class members in the constructor, by adding a visibility modifiers to the parameter. Example Get your own TypeScript Server. … signs of a broken shin bone